Irish Seafood Pie with Oat Topping

A comforting and hearty pie filled with a creamy mixture of flaky white fish, salmon, and prawns, topped with a golden, crunchy oat crust.

Prep30 minutes
Cook35 minutes
Total1 hour 5 minutes
Serves6
LevelMedium
Irish Seafood Pie with Oat Topping - Ireland traditional dish

๐Ÿง‚ Ingredients

  • 300 g White fish fillets(e.g., cod, haddock; cut into chunks)
  • 200 g Salmon fillet(skinless, cut into chunks)
  • 150 g Prawns(peeled and deveined)
  • 50 g Butter
  • 1 medium Onion(finely chopped)
  • 2 medium Leeks(white and light green parts, thinly sliced)
  • 40 g Plain flour
  • 500 ml Milk
  • 100 ml Fish or vegetable stock
  • 2 tbsp Fresh dill(chopped)
  • 2 tbsp Fresh parsley(chopped)
  • 1 tbsp Lemon juice
  • 1 tsp Salt
  • 0.5 tsp Black pepper(freshly ground)
  • 75 g Rolled oats
  • 30 g Butter(melted)
  • 50 g Grated cheddar cheese(optional, for topping)

๐Ÿ’ก Pro Tips

  • โœ“You can add other seafood like mussels or scallops.
  • โœ“For a richer sauce, use half milk and half double cream.
  • โœ“Ensure the oat topping is spread evenly for consistent crispiness.

โœจ Twist Ideas

Inspiration for your own version of this recipe

  • Add a splash of dry white wine to the sauce for extra flavor.
  • Include some cooked peas or sweetcorn for added color and sweetness.
  • A pinch of cayenne pepper can add a subtle heat.
